NAGPUR: Maharashtra home minister
Anil Deshmukh, Nagpur police commissioner BK Upadhyay, Zonal DCP Rahul Maknikar and others inspected Shatranjipura sealing at
Sunil Hotel Chowk at Lakkadganj and also discussed about the enforcement of lockdown plan in the backdrop of Covid-19 threat.
Home minister Deshmukh had keenly reviewed the sealing point of the
Shantranjipura containment area where at least 55 Covid-19 positive patients have been found.
Deshmukh asked about the police deployment and measures being taken to enforce the sealing at the cut-off points. He also had asked about the family details of the Covid-19 patients and their possible connections to the
Tabhligi jamaat at Nizamuddin.
CP Deshmukh, zonal DCP Maknikar and Senior PI Narendra Hiware of Lakadganj police station explained Deshmukh about the police deployments and also measures like public announcements through volunteers like Covid Yodhha scheme.
Deshmukh later took a tour of the entire city crossing the crucial junctions of Jagnade chowk, Manewada Chowk, Chhatrapati chowk, Rahate Colony square, Deekshabhoomi chowk, Shankarnagar chowk, Law college Square and some more places before returning to his office.
